Output 7514664881562a73658c384e042c362ac3afe0281c89e2d6dff21ce2bb688779:1

value
606555
script pubkey
OP_0 OP_PUSHBYTES_20 5810401ea972b03b7a3b4a3856b5d4d8723658d9
address
bc1qtqgyq84fw2crk73mfgu9ddw5mpervkxeedrzqt
transaction
7514664881562a73658c384e042c362ac3afe0281c89e2d6dff21ce2bb688779